Etymology edit

Inherited from Sanskrit गण्ड (gaṇḍá). Cognate with Assamese গাঁৰ (gãr).

Pronunciation edit

Noun edit

گانْڈ (gānḍf (Hindi spelling गांड)

  1. (vulgar slang) asshole, butthole (the anus)
